Sair da sessão do NetScaler no iframe causa perda de sessão do asp.net no IE

0

Esta não é realmente uma questão de programação ou uma questão de administração de servidor, mais uma questão de comportamento do navegador.

No IE (com certeza 7 e 8, testando 9 em breve), estou visitando o site A.com e isso abre um iframe que exibe o site B.com. Estou logado no site A (tenho um cookie asp.net_SessionId), e no iframe faço login no site B (recebo um cookie do netscaler NSC_AAAC). Quando faço logout da sessão netscaler para o site B no iframe (obtendo uma resposta que define um valor falso e uma data de expiração no passado para esse cookie), minha próxima solicitação ao site A não envia um cookie asp.net_sessionID, efetivamente me desconectando do site A.

Isso é um bug do navegador? (Acho que sim, porque o FireFox e o Chrome não se comportam dessa maneira) e, em caso afirmativo, o que posso fazer para evitar que isso aconteça?

    
por Peter T. LaComb Jr. 17.05.2012 / 17:56

1 resposta

0

Talvez seja o mecanismo de pesquisa. O Google parece roubar alguns cookies para um determinado site que eu uso, desconectando-me apesar de marcar 'me autentique automaticamente'. Outros usuários reclamam do mesmo problema que também usam o Google. Desde que usei o mecanismo de pesquisa do ixquick, não experimentei o problema.

    
por 21.12.2012 / 22:23